Abstract:
Cooperative communication has been receiving significant attention in recent years because of the great potential for performance improvement. In this paper, we will consider the joint design of transmit and cooperative beamforming vectors in cooperative systems with a multi-antenna source and multiple single-antenna relays. The cooperative beamforming, performed by distributed relay nodes, is different from the conventional transmit beamforming in multiple-input and multiple-output (MIMO) systems because each node only has access to the channel information of its own links. With instantaneous channel state information (CSI), the optimal beamforming vectors (transmit and cooperative) will maximize the received SNR by allocating power among different relay links, and each relay can determine the optimal operation in a distributed manner. If only statistical CSI is available, it is shown that the optimal transmit scheme degenerates to a relay selection algorithm where only one relay link is active.
